Review the debtor ledger and prioritise collection activities to ensure timely payment of invoices. Send monthly statements and payment reminders via phone and email. Build positive customer relationships by resolving invoice queries professionally and promptly. Collaborate with Sales and Customer Service teams to support credit and collection processes. Work with Accountants to reconcile accounts and minimise unallocated receipts. Maintain accurate records of credit transactions, customer interactions, and payment histories. Act as the first point of contact for collections activities within your assigned region. Perform other duties as required to support the credit function. Minimum 5 years’ experience in Credit Collections within a commercial environment. CICM qualification (or working towards) is desirable. Strong written and verbal communication skills. Good understanding of industry practices, economic environments, company policies, and regional laws. Experience with vendor program structures in sales or credit underwriting. Proficiency in SAP and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int). Analytical mindset with the ability to evaluate situations and apply sound judgment. WHO WE ARE Shure’s mission is to be the most trusted audio brand worldwide – and for over a century, our Core Values have aligned us to be just that. Founded in 1925, we are a leading global manufacturer of audio equipment known for quality, reliability, and durability. We engineer microphones, headphones, wireless audio systems, conferencing systems, and more. And quality doesn’t stop at our products. Our talented teams strive for perfection and innovate every chance they get. We offer an Associate-first culture, flexible work arrangements, and opportunity for all. Shure is headquartered in United States. We have more than 35 regional sales offices, engineering hubs, distribution centers and manufacturing facilities throughout the Americas, EMEA, and Asia.
